MySQL
chenyuting
这个作者很懒,什么都没留下…
展开
-
三种数据库支持的事务隔离级别
Oracle只提供Read committed和Serializable两个标准隔离级别,另外还提供自己定义的Read only隔离级别; SQL Server除支持上述ISO/ANSI SQL92定义的4个隔离级别外,还支持一个叫做“快照”的隔离级别,但严格来说它是一个用MVCC实现的Serializable隔离级别。 MySQL支持全部4个隔离级别,但在翻译 2009-06-09 15:47:00 · 447 阅读 · 0 评论 -
MVCC(多版本并发控制,MultiVersion Concurrency Control)
MVCC是实现事务隔离级别的一种机制 通过一定机制生成一个数据请求时间点的一致性数据快照(Snapshot),并用这个快照来提供一定级别(语句级或事务级)的一致性读取。从用户的角度来看,好象是数据库可以提供同一数据的多个版本,因此,这种技术叫做数据多版本并发控制(MultiVersion Concurrency Control,简称MVCC或MCC),也经常称为多版本数据库原创 2009-06-09 15:46:00 · 1272 阅读 · 1 评论